Web6 aug. 2024 · Okra’s Nutritional Benefits Okra is packed with important vitamins and minerals, including vitamin B6, B1, folic acid, magnesium, and manganese, making it an excellent methylation-supporting food. Okra also offers substantial amounts of vitamins A and C, making it a high-antioxidant food, great for supporting eyesight and healthy skin. WebOkra seeds.
